MALABAR SLENDER LORIS
Slender loris: One of the cutest nocturnal strepsirrhine primate on this planet, which is endemic to the rainforests of western ghats. They are mainly insectivorous and sometime hunts lizards as well as sleeping birds.
Scientific name: Loris lydekkerianus

KARWAR BURROWING TARUNTULA
It's distinguished by its unique burrowing behavior, constructing intricate burrows in soil and leaf litter for shelter. Adaptations like sensitive hairs aid in detecting vibrations, crucial for sensing prey and threats. With specialized coloration for camouflage, it remains elusive in its forest habitat.

TIGER CENTIPEDE
One unique feature of Scolopendra polymorpha, the desert tiger centipede, is its venomous claws, called forcipules, which it uses to capture prey. Additionally, it displays a distinct coloration pattern with alternating bands of yellow or orange and black along its body, serving as a warning to potential predators.
